    Angel Harps Protest Panyard Destruction
    (Express, 6-Sep-74) Lewis, Roderick; The University of the West Indies, St Augustine Campus, Trinidad and Tobago
    Pan Trinbago has called for an investigation into the circumstances leading to the destruction of Angel Harps Steel Orchestra's panyard on Main Street, Arima. Representatives from the steelbands highlighted that the actions were taken followed instructions from the Crown Lands Divisions. Cedric Campbell, Public Relations Officer, for the region, stated that the land was given to Angel Harps by the Crown Lands Division following a visit by the Prime Minister in 1969.

    Beautiful Music at Pan Festival
    (Express, 4-Dec-73) Lewis, Roderick; The University of the West Indies, St Augustine Campus, Trinidad and Tobago
    The finals of the 1973 Steelband Music Festival has been able to convince those who think of pan as a 'carnival instrument' to think otherwise. The six bands competing in category "B" showed how serious they were by their discipline and generally polished performances. East Side Symphony emerged winners with the overture from "Rosamunde" by Schubert. There is a review of the other steelbands performances and their placements.

    British Company to Mass-Produce Trinidad- Invented Instrument: Foreign Pans May Soon Be On Local Store Shelves
    (Express, 1-Dec-73) Lewis, Roderick; The University of the West Indies, St Augustine Campus, Trinidad and Tobago
    A British company, 'Steelband Promotions' has pioneered a technique in steelband production that is more advanced than Trinidad and Tobago where it originated. The company's move to mass-produce pans came in the wake of steelband music being introduced in the curriculum for schools throughout England. Local panmen may soon be buying pans manufactured in England.
